Elvira (1038–1101)
Elvira (1038–1101)
Princess of Castile. Born in 1038; died on November 15, 1101; daughter of Sancha of Leon (1013–1067) and Ferdinand I (c. 1017–1065), king of Castile and Leon (r. 1038–1065).
